According to the IDEX Index, published by IDEX Online, polished prices kept rising overall during March although there were more price drops “among both rounds and fancies than have seen of late.”
Among Round diamonds, price increases dominated for most sizes, although there were more drops than in recent months. Prices rose most 1.50-carat-4.99-carat goods, K+ and SI3+. Prices also rose among 1.00-carat-1.24-carat goods, J+ and SI1+. However, there were price falls in D-E/VS2-SI3. 5.00-carat-5.99-carat goods saw “a near-even mix of increases and decreases.”
Among Fancy diamonds, there were many price rises among all sizes, except those under 0.30-carats. However, there were “significantly more reductions,” especially among 1.00-carat-1.24-carat goods.
